A carbon C60 fullerene ball-and-stick model suitable for direct classroom teaching
Model Features
- Designed strictly according to C60 molecular symmetry, clearly displaying the spatial configuration of the truncated icosahedron and the sp² hybridized carbon framework
- Print in Place and formed directly, eliminating assembly steps, and offering superior structural strength compared to multi-part assembly
- Moderate size, can be held and rotated for observation, convenient for explaining fullerene structure, conjugated systems, and molecular symmetry

Printing Parameters
- Layer height: 0.2 mm
- Wall thickness: 3 walls
- Infill: 40%
Support Tips
Due to the caged ball-and-stick structure having many overhangs, it is recommended to enable tree supports (slim tree). Clean supports carefully to avoid damaging the rods
